Man to end Woonsocket to Woonsocket walk Saturday

A Woonsocket, R.I. man is finishing up his 1700-mile walk this weekend in his hometown’s sister city of Woonsocket, SD.
Bill Fagan began his journey nearly four years ago walking the route on and off, flying home periodically and then returning to the spot where he left off.
This leg of his journey began in Trimont, Minn. He and his wife, who is accompanying him on the final leg in a rental car, flew into Minneapolis a week ago and drove to Trimont to begin the walk.
Fagan’s final leg took him through Windom, Slayton and Pipestone, Minn. Entering South Dakota, he is walking west on Highway 34 and at press time Tuesday had just left Madison.
He may arrive in the area a day or two before the expected Oct. 6 official arrival date, but will make the final walk into Woonsocket on Saturday, when the rest of his family can be there.
Fagan, an avid walker, who often takes nine-mile walks to a neighboring town of Mendon, Mass., decided a few years ago he wanted to take a longer walk. He considered going cross-country or along the Appalachian Trail, but chose the trip to Woonsocket because he wanted the route to be unique.
